Surrounded by ancient organic olive groves on a winery in Abruzzo, you might feel quite intoxicated by the stunning scenery at Cirelli Wine Glamping. The white gravel road at the entrance is flanked by vineyards and olive groves, and sets the tone for the site: relaxing, quiet and ecological. Expect a warm welcome from the Cirelli family upon your arrival. Based on a winery, the farm is a wildlife haven with shade from olive trees, areas of untamed nature, a small vegetable garden and several animals. Still, this isn’t a back-to-basics place, although it feels almost like you’re staying in the outdoors. The pinewood lodges have an ensuite bathroom with hot water, a toilet and a shower, as well as modern furniture including a double bed and one single bed on a mezzanine level. The lodges have all-in-one heating and air conditioning or a bed warmer and blankets for chillier nights. Spaced out from your neighbours, you’ll have plenty of peace and quiet too, plus constant shade from the PVC roof. Head to the kitchen corner in your lodge for your lunch, dinner or aperitivo. The site sells organic products, and in the fridge there's a selection of wine. Other goods can be sourced at the local food shop 10 minutes’ drive away. While you’re out and about, Centro Visite Oasi WWF Calanchi di Atri is just 15 minutes' drive away. There’s a free walking route through the reserve's Badlands, worn away by erosion, with the Adriatic Sea on one side (12 kilometres away) and the Gran Sasso D’Italia mountain on the other (73 kilometres away).

How does simple cuisine like kebabs, cod and grilled meat accompanied by sea and mountain views sound? The Agriturismo La Casetta in Campagna (10 minutes’ drive) provides all of this. You’ll quickly find there’s a great mix of seafood, wine and local dishes in Atri (20 minutes) too. Just don’t dine so long that you miss seeing the city's art centre, city park, cathedral and sweet shop… Of course, the Adriatic coast should be very high on your list of adventures. Beaches include Pineta di Pineto (half an hour), Twenty Beach (20 minutes), Novavita Beach (55 minutes) and Chalet Luna Rossa (40 minutes). You might like to pedal between the lidos along the Bike to Coast cycle path, which can be picked up from Pineta di Pineto. A horse riding school, cycling tours and breweries are all within around 10 kilometres of the site too, so there's plenty to keep those active adventures coming. For more cities though, head to Città Sant'Angelo (20 minutes) or Pescara (40 minutes). The latter's lively seafront has 16 kilometres of golden sand.
